Instrumentation OP Amps Buffer Amps Texas Instruments OPA180IDR Overview

The Texas Instruments OPA180IDR is an integrated circuit operational amplifier (op-amp) designed for precision applications in instrumentation, buffer, and signal conditioning circuits. With its zero-drift architecture, this op-amp delivers unparalleled accuracy and stability, making it an ideal choice for demanding industrial and scientific applications.

Featuring a single channel in an 8-SOIC package, the OPA180IDR offers simplicity in design and ease of integration, allowing engineers to optimize board space and reduce overall system complexity. Its wide supply voltage range and low quiescent current make it suitable for battery-powered and portable devices, further enhancing its versatility.

Whether you're designing measurement instruments, data acquisition systems, or precision voltage references, the OPA180IDR from Texas Instruments provides the performance and reliability required to meet the stringent demands of modern electronic systems.

OPA180IDR Applications

  • Data acquisition systems: The OPA180IDR excels in precision voltage measurement and signal conditioning, making it an ideal choice for data acquisition front-end circuits. Its low offset voltage and high CMRR ensure accurate signal processing, even in noisy environments.
  • Medical instrumentation: In medical devices such as patient monitors and diagnostic equipment, the OPA180IDR provides the necessary precision and stability for accurate sensor interfacing and signal amplification. Its low power consumption is well-suited for battery-powered applications.
  • Industrial automation: From process control to test and measurement equipment, industrial automation relies on precise signal conditioning and amplification. The OPA180IDR's zero-drift architecture ensures long-term stability, making it suitable for harsh industrial environments.
